Serve xxxx Eggplant Souffle 1 cup milk 1% cups bread cubes 1 cup cooked eggplant 4 tablespoons butter y 2 teaspoon salt Vs teaspoon pepper 2 egg yolks, well beaten 2 egg whites, stiffly beaten Heat milk, add bread cubes and cook to a thick paste. Add eggplant, salt, pepper and butter. Remove from heat. Add egg yolks. Fold in stiffly beaten egg whites. Place in a greased baking dish and bake in 375 degree oven for 20 to 25 minutes, xxxx Exotic Cheese Cake Combine 1 cup shredded coconut, 2 tablespoons each of flour and melted margarine. Press on bottom of 9 inch spring pan. Bake at 350 degrees for 12 to 15 minutes. Soften 1 envelope unflavored gelatin in Vi cup cold water. Combine 3 egg yolks, % cup water and % cup sugar in saucepan. Stir over medium heat 5 minutes. Add gelatin and stir till dissolved. Gradually add gelatin mixture to two 8 oz. pkg of cream cheese, softened. Mix till blended. Stir in Vi cup lime juice, few drops of green food coloring. Fold in 1 cup whipped cream and 3 stiffly beaten egg whites. Pour over crust. Chill until firm. Decorate top as desired. You can change the flavors to lemon or orange and add food coloring to match the flavor. xxxx Milk Chocolate Cake 2Vi cups sugar 3 tablespoons water 2 squares semi-sweet chocolate, melted % cup soft margarine or butter 1 teaspoon vanilla extract 4 eggs , separated 2Vi cups sifted cake flour 1 teaspoon cream of tartar Vz teaspoon soda Vz teasnoon salt 1 cup milk Stir Vi cup sugar and the water into melted chocolate. Cream butter and the remaining 2 cups sugar. Add vanilla then egg yolks, one at a time, beating well after each addition. Add chocolate mixture and blend. Add sifted flour, cream of tartar, soda, salt, alternately with 1 cup milk. Beat until smooth. Fold in stiffly beaten egg whites. Pour into three 9-inch layer pans, lined with wax paper. Bake at 350 degrees about 35 minutes. Bake at 400 degrees for 10 minutes, then 375 for 40 minutes or till center is set. xxxx Delicious Cream Pie 1 cup plus 2 tablespoons sugar 1 envelope none flavored gelatin whites of 5 eggs 1 pint whipping cream Soak gelatin in 4-tablespoons cold water, over hot water until dissolved. Boil sugar in 5 tablespoons Water until it spins a thread. Pour slowly over beaten egg whites, beat as you pour. Fold in soaked gelatin, then fold in whipped cream. DO NOT BEAT. Add 1 teaspoon vanilla and a small amount of almond extract. Pour into two 9-inch graham cracker crumb crusts. Chill well.
